Sister act pensacola little theatre9/15/2023 ![]() ![]() Rocky wrote and directed his first musical in 1998, which opened on The Little Theatre Off Broadway, a local theatre he opened that year with his mother, Elvia Martinez-Montez. By the time he was 19, he was stage-managing full productions, acting as properties master, and in the dance troupe. Rockcliffe Montez (AKA “Rocky”), a San Antonio, Texas native, started performing in local community theatre at the young age of 16. With her contribution of decades of experience in entertainment and production, Elvia is an integral part of the Gumshoe Society team. Washer Masonic Lodge, San Antonio, Texas. Elvia has also produced events for the Ghost Seekers of Texas, creating and managing fundraising events for historical locations, such as the Pensacola Lighthouse and Museum, Pensacola, Florida, The Alameda Theatre and the Nat M. From that point forward, Elvia and Rocky became a business team, directing, writing, and performing in numerous theatrical events across the city. Partnering with her son Rocky in 1998, Elvia opened The Little Theatre Off Broadway in San Antonio, Texas.
